Incorrect Email or Password
If you see this message, it means either your email address or password doesn’t match what we have on file—or your account might not exist yet. Double-check for any typos, and if you’ve forgotten your password, simply click "Forgot Password" to reset it and regain access.
Account Not Activated
This message pops up if you’ve signed up but haven’t verified your email yet. Make sure to check your inbox (and don’t forget your spam/junk folder!) for the verification email. If it’s nowhere to be found, you can always request a new verification email.
Account Not Linked
You may see this message if you’re trying to log in using Facebook or Google, but the email you’re using is already linked to an existing email/password account. No worries—just log in using your email and password first, then go to your account settings to link your social accounts (Facebook or Google).
Office 365, Facebook, or Google Sign-In Only
If you see this message, it means your account is set up with Office 365, Facebook, or Google, instead of the traditional email/password login. To access your account, simply click the appropriate login button for Office 365, Facebook, or Google beneath the email/password fields.
